TL;DR Summary

FirstEnergy expects to restore power to most of its customers served by Ohio Edison by 4 p.m. Wednesday, March 29, after a storm caused power outages in northern and central Ohio. As of Sunday afternoon, 53,300 customers remained without service. Trumbull County had the most extensive outages, with 12,126 or 15% of the county still without power. Penn Power reported approximately 54,900 customers in western Pennsylvania lost power due to the storm, and 13,000 remained without service by Sunday afternoon.
